QUEEN OF WANDS
Confidence, magnetism, the strength that inspires
The Queen of Wands represents personal confidence, magnetism and leadership through authenticity.
General meaning
The Queen of Wands represents a mature and steady form of active energy within the Minor Arcana. It is no longer about youthful impulse or constant movement, but about presence. This figure does not need to prove too much in order to be noticed: her confidence, clarity and inner fire speak for her.
This card symbolizes confidence. Not empty or superficial confidence, but one that is born from self-knowledge. In the language of tarot, wands express vitality, initiative and creative force, and the Queen shows how that energy can be sustained with intelligence, character and charisma.
When it appears in a reading, it may point to a strong, creative, independent person or someone with great leadership ability. It may also be inviting you to take that place: trust your voice, your decisions and your way of being in the world.
Within the tarot, this card is also linked to personal magnetism. The Queen of Wands does not draw others by imposition, but by presence. She inspires, activates, motivates and ignites in others the desire to act or to believe more in themselves.
On a deeper level, this figure represents inner sovereignty. It is the part of you that no longer needs permission to move forward, create or show itself. It knows what it wants and usually acts with a very valuable combination of firmness and warmth.
Interpretation in a reading
In a spread, its appearance is usually favorable. In love, it can speak of strong attraction, authenticity or bonds where there is desire and clarity. At work, it points to leadership, visibility, initiative or projects that depend greatly on your personal confidence. Shadow or challenge
Its shadow appears when confidence becomes pride, when magnetism turns into a need for control or when inner fire becomes impatience with others. Having power also means knowing how to measure it.
